AlFeN3 is an iron-aluminum nitride compound, representing a transition metal nitride in the family of hard ceramic materials. While not widely documented in mainstream engineering databases, this composition falls within research-phase intermetallic nitrides being investigated for wear resistance and high-temperature stability. Interest in such materials stems from their potential to combine aluminum's light weight with iron's abundance and nitride ceramics' hardness, positioning them as exploratory candidates for demanding mechanical and thermal applications where cost and density constraints favor alternatives to conventional tungsten carbides or titanium nitrides.
